DH Poseka: Downhill Returns to Koroška After 14 Years

After a successful start of this year’s Slovenian series 20chocolate Downhill Cup in Dolenjska, another new venue will follow just two weeks later, on Sunday 1 June: the Poseka Bike Park, Ravne na Koroškem.

dh poseka

The venue and the terrain are not as unfamiliar as the Gorjanci were. Many people have ridden in the park, which opened in 2018 and is constantly being upgraded and modernised, set practically in the town of Ravne na Koroškem in Northern Slovenia. A ski lift, adapted for cyclists with the EasyLoop system, takes care of uplift. The trails have 160 vertical metres of drop.

The downhill course in the park is called Divja jaga, and for the race it will have an addition at the top with a start just behind the top of the lift and another one at the bottom, leading all the way to the finish in the Ravne Sports Park. The core of the course remains, where the features are roots, open or bermed turns and some jumps. There will also be some line picking, says course chief Matej Kodrin, a former racer.

The riders will, however, be on the track for a much shorter time than on DH Planina. The 1030 m long course is expected to take about one and a half minutes, but more precise times are not yet known.

A Koroška Tradition

Lest anyone think that the Koroška only has enduro, as they have Vid Peršak and Nežka Libnik and all the other enduro stars, and the history of the Black Hole Enduro with the Enduro World Series. The first downhill race in Koroška was held in 1995 in Črna na Koroškem, called Divja jaga, so the name of the trail in Poseka is a kind of tribute to this legacy. The last Divja jaga was held in 2007, the national championship, and the year before that the race was also held in Mežica. Even closer to Ravne, the race with the finish on Lake Ivarčko was held from 2001 to 2004 and from 2009 to 2011.

Poseka also has its own history. Since 2005, members of the Ravne Cycling Club have held cross-country races here, including a UCI international first category race and two national championships, and the 2019 National Championship was also the last cross-country race held here. In 2018 and 2019, they also hosted SloEnduro 4Fun series events.

The Field

Entries close on Monday 25 May, so we can only speculate on participation. In addition to the fastest from Planina, the slower, more technical course promises more challengers on enduro bikes. Among the registered riders are two-time overall SloEnduro winner Miha Smrdel, last year’s fastest Slovenian in Lienz downhill, and local junior Nežka Libnik, last weekend’s World Cup winner in enduro, who tried downhill for the first time last year at Kope – and won.

Many more enduro riders from Koroška will appear on the list. Vid Peršak, unfortunately, probably won’t, unless he is not getting any rest after the World Cup in France, where the enduro race will be held on Friday.

Schedule

Saturday’s track riding from 9am to 5pm will be relaxed on a short course and with an almost unlimited number of laps alongside a lift with a capacity of 450 riders per hour. There will also be plenty of time for training on Sunday, between 9am and 1pm. As usual, the seeding run starts at 13:30 and the final at 16:00.

Please note the slight change in the time for collecting the number plates: from 17:00 to 19:00 on Saturday and from 07:30 to 08:30 on Sunday.
